FG Mobilises $1.02 bn to Convert Vehicles to CNG
FG (formerly FuelGen) announced a $1.02 billion financing plan to convert a fleet of vehicles—primarily buses, trucks and municipal fleets—to run on compressed natural gas (CNG). The program, funded through a mix of private investment, government grants and green bonds, aims to replace diesel engines with CNG systems, cutting emissions by up to 30 % and supporting national clean‑fuel targets.
